Aroma, Flavor and Terpene Profile

Break open a cured bud and the first wave that hits you is sweet lemon zest with a slightly damp earthiness underneath — think fresh-squeezed citrus over a forest floor after rain. As the bud warms, deeper notes emerge: ripe berry sweetness and a faint spice that lingers at the back of the throat. On the exhale, the flavor rounds into something almost dessert-like — sweet and earthy with a citrus finish that keeps the palate interested long after the smoke clears.

Four terpenes define this sensory experience, each playing a distinct role in both flavor and effect.

Myrcene sits at 0.51%, making it a co-dominant force in this profile. Myrcene brings the deep earthiness and subtle fruit that anchors the aroma and may be responsible for the smooth, mellow body effect that differentiates this cross from pure Amnesia Haze expressions. Research suggests Myrcene enhances cannabinoid permeability across the blood-brain barrier — which may partly explain the rapid onset of this strain's cerebral effects.

Caryophyllene also registers at 0.51%, matching Myrcene and adding the spicy, peppery edge that sharpens both the aroma and the flavor on the back end. Caryophyllene is unique among cannabis terpenes because it directly activates CB2 receptors in the endocannabinoid system, contributing anti-inflammatory effects that complement the strain's physical relief profile without any psychoactive component of its own.

Pinene at 0.45% is the terpene that keeps this strain feeling mentally clear rather than foggy. That fresh, almost piney brightness you detect mid-inhale is Pinene at work — and beyond flavor, it's associated with bronchodilation and may offset short-term memory impairment sometimes linked to high-THC sativas, keeping the experience sharp and coherent.

Phellandrene rounds out the profile with a fresh, slightly minty and citrusy character that ties the whole aroma together. It's less studied than the other three, but its presence adds a distinctive brightness that gives Northern Lights x Amnesia Haze its particularly clean, lifted scent — distinct from heavier, more resinous Haze expressions.

Growing Northern Lights x Amnesia Haze Seeds

This is genuinely one of the more forgiving sativa-dominant hybrids you'll encounter — rated easy difficulty, and that rating holds up in practice. Northern Lights genetics contribute structural stability and pest resistance that offset the slight finickiness Amnesia Haze can express in less controlled environments. The plant stays medium in size, which makes it manageable in both tent grows and outdoor garden beds without requiring aggressive canopy control from day one.

Indoors, target temperatures of 70–80°F (21–27°C) during the vegetative phase, dropping slightly to 65–75°F (18–24°C) during flowering to encourage terpene production and trichome density. Humidity should sit at 50–60% through veg and drop progressively to 40–45% as buds bulk in late flower — this matters more than most growers realize, because Amnesia Haze heritage can make buds susceptible to moisture retention in dense colas. Outdoors, this strain thrives in warm temperate climates and performs well in the northern hemisphere from June through October.

Key growing tips for getting the best out of this strain:

  • Training: Apply LST or topping early in veg to widen the canopy and expose lower bud sites — the sativa structure benefits significantly from horizontal spreading
  • Vegetative nutrition: Feed moderate nitrogen during the vegetative stage, keeping EC between 1.2–1.8 to build strong internodal structure without stretching
  • Nutrients at flower flip: Follow a structured phosphorus and potassium ramp from week 3 of flower onward — reduce nitrogen steadily from week 2 to prevent leafy, airy buds

To maximize your harvest:

  • Trichome timing: Harvest when 70–80% of trichomes are milky white with 10–15% amber — this locks in peak THC and terpene expression before significant degradation begins
  • Late-flower humidity: Drop to 40–45% RH in the final two weeks to concentrate resin production and protect dense colas from late-stage mold
  • Flush protocol: Flush with plain pH-adjusted water for the final 7–10 days of flower to clear any residual nutrient salts and improve the smoothness of the final smoke
  • Drying and curing: Slow dry for 10–14 days at 60–65°F / 55–60% RH, then jar-cure for a minimum of 3–4 weeks — the citrus and berry terpenes in this strain develop dramatically with proper curing time
